Solar Project Solutions’ 20 MW Atwell Island Solar Farm

A joint venture between Samsung and Enco brings solar to Tulare County.

This week, Quanta Services announced that it has been selected as the engineering, procurement, and construction provider for the 20-megawatt Atwell Island solar farm in Tulare County, California. Solar Project Solutions, LLC (SPS), a joint venture between Samsung Green Repower and Enco Utility Services, is developing the project. Engineering is currently underway and construction is expected to begin by the end of the month.

A 25-year power purchase agreement with Pacific Gas & Electric was approved by the California Public Utilities Commission last November. Upon completion in August 2012, the project is expected to provide approximately 42,200 megawatt-hours of power into the grid annually.

SPS is currently developing four additional projects in California: Alpaugh North (20 megawatts), White River (20 megawatts), Alpaugh (50 megawatts) in Tulare County, and Corcoran (20 megawatts) in Kings County.
